Overview
The primary responsibility of the Regional Sales and Marketing Manager is to build, lead, train and support the cafe Sales & Marketing managers and coordinators in the field to optimize the potential top line sales within each market. Regionals are also responsible for ensuring that all sales and marketing initiatives obtain the desired profit margins. This person needs to develop creative strategic initiatives leveraging relationships to drive top line cafe and retail sales while heightening consumer awareness. The regional will also assist in the development of sale strategies for all cafe operations with emphasis on maintaining consistent direction and vision through the entire field sales force and cafe management teams.
The Regional Sales and Marketing Manager is a highly visible and complex role, since the candidate will be required to support and work with all cafes, departments, and leadership team across the entire organization and work directly with the Directors of Sales & Marketing to deliver on the overall company strategic plan while being involved with the development of the local business plans.
